In John's pic, the person on the extreme left looks like Mj Hans Georg Herzog, Kmdr, II/PzRGt14. He was RKT'ed on 06.04.44. Second from left was Karl Decker, Kmdr 5 Pz from 07.09.43 to 16.10.44.

Friedrich got his RK on 06.04.43 but DKiG on 10.01.44.

This would put the pic having been taken between April 44 to Oct 44. The background clearly was not summer so that would narrow down the number of possible RKTs as candidate for the yet unnamed man -- looks like he was just awarded the RK.

Dear Hannes

If Kertsch is where the RKT died, then there are the following possibilities.

Kociok, Josef
Ofw., Flugzeugfhr. i. d. 10. (N.J.)Z.G. 1
RK 31.07.43
+ 26.9.43 bei Kertsch (Rußland) nach Zusammenstoß mit einem sowjet. Flugzeug tödl. verungluckt als Flugzeugfhr. im N.J.G. 200; nachträglich zum Lt. befördert

Künkel, Christian
Lt., Flugzeugfhr. i. d. 8./S.G. 3
RK 26.03.44
+ 27.1.44 bei Kertsch (Rußland); nachträglich zum Oblt. befördert

Sattler, Hans-Karl
Oblt., Flugzeugfhr. i. d. 8./S.G. 77
RK 16.02.42
+ 13.1.43 bei Kertsch (Rußland) als Staffelkpt.

Stegmann, Karl
Uffz., Hilfsbeobachter i. d. 7./Art.Rgt. 198
RK 20.01.44
+ 6.11.43 auf Halbinsel Kertsch (Rußland); nachträglich zum Wachtm. befördert

Waldhauser, Johann
Oblt., Staffelkpt. 9./S.G. 77
RK 24.01.42
+ 13.5.42 bei Kertsch (Rußland)

I hope this helps.
